I believe it is worth the trip to go to a nearby Walgreens if you plan on taking TONS of pics.

The Disney machines cost $12 per CD, but they are limited to 120 pics per CD.

Walgreens charges $2.99 per CD, with the only limit being how many of your camera's pics will fit on teh CD. All in all, a much better bargain, particularly if you want to get a new CD made every day.
